A clinical research to evaluate the safety and efficacy of study drug Pyrotinib compare with Docetaxel for patients with advanced lung cancer

A Phase 3, Randomized , Open-Label, Multicenter Study of the Efficacy and Safety of Pyrotinib versus Docetaxel in Patients with Advanced Non-squamous Non-small Cell Lung Cancer (NSCLC) Harboring a HER2 Exon 20 Mutation who progressed on or after Treatment with Platinum Based Chemotherapy

Inclusion criteria

Inclusion criteria: 1. Capable of giving informed consent. Signed and dated written informed consent which is approved by IRB/EC, willing and able to comply with scheduled treatment, all examinations at study visits, and other study procedures. 2. Male or female, =18 years old. 3. ECOG PS 0-1 (see APPENDIX 2 for ECOG PS criteria). 4. Have histologically or cytologically confirmed locally advanced (must have been evaluated by the investigator that are not amenable to curable surgery or radiotherapy) or metastatic non-squamous NSCLC disease (Stage IIIB – IV, according to the International Association for the Study of Lung Cancer (IASLC) cancer staging system, 8th edition [APPENDIX 3]). 5. Before enrollment, a documented confirmed presence of activating mutations in exon 20 of the HER2 gene in tumors must be provided. Sufficient tumor tissue samples should be provided to retrospectively confirm/detect the mutation status of the HER2 gene, for companion diagnostic development. The activating mutations should be interpreted as clinically significant mutations by public databases. For examples of suspected/confirmed gain-of-function HER2 (ERBB2) exon 20 mutations. The tumor tissue samples should be: neutral buffered formalin fixed, paraffin-embedded [FFPE] blocks or at least 6-12 unstained (6-10 surgical biopsies, or at least 12 core needle biopsies) tumor tissue slices, fresh or archived (fresh samples are preferred). For patients who cannot provide the required biopsies, their enrollment can be discussed with the sponsor. 6. Must have measurable disease per RECIST v1.1. The definition of CT or MRI measurable lesion as the target lesion: according to RECIST v1.1, the long diameter of such lesion should be =10 mm by the spiral CT scan or the short diameter of enlarged lymph nodes =15 mm; lesions that have previously received local treatment can be used as target lesions after the confirmation of progress according to the RECIST v1.1 standard. 7. For advanced NSCLC, patients must have had progressive disease on or after a platinum based chemotherapy, with or without immune checkpoint inhibitors (PD-1/PD-L1 inhibitors) and/or anti-angiogenic drugs. No more than 2 prior lines of systemic therapy are allowed. Two scenarios of neoadjuvant/adjuvant therapy are allowed: a) subjects who received adjuvant or neoadjuvant platinum based chemotherapy and developed recurrent or metastatic disease within 6 months of completing therapy are eligible; b) subjects with recurrent disease > 6 months after adjuvant or neoadjuvant platinum-based chemotherapy, who also subsequently progressed during or after a platinum based regimen given to treat the recurrence, are eligible. 8. The laboratory test values must meet the following standards to manifest that the functional level of important organs/systems meets the requirements: • Hematology (not corrected by blood/blood products transfusion, or transfusion of hematopoietic stimulating factors such as G-CSF/TPO, etc. within 14 days before the test): ANC=1.5 × 109/L; PLT=100 × 109/L; Hb=80 g/L; • Blood biochemistry (liver function): TBIL = 1.0 × ULN; ALT and/or AST = 1.5 × ULN AND alkaline phosphatase (ALP) =2.5×ULN. • Blood biochemistry (renal function): Cr=1.5 × ULN and CrCL=50 mL/min (Cockcroft-Gault formula); 9. Females of childbearing potential (WOCBP) must have a serum pregnancy test within 7 days before the first dose and the result is negative. Main Objective: To compare the progression-free survival (PFS) of pyrotinib versus docetaxel in patients with advanced non-squamous non-small cell lung cancer (NSCLC) harboring a HER2 exon 20 mutation who progressed after treatment with platinum based chemotherapy. The PFS endpoint will be determined by blinded independent radiology review committee (BIRC).;Secondary Objective: - To compare the efficacy of pyrotinib versus docetaxel in patients with advanced HER2 exon20-mutated non-squamous NSCLC who have progressed after treated with platinum based chemotherapy , through evaluations of overall survival (OS), and objective response rate (ORR), disease control rate (DCR), duration of response (DoR), and time to tumor progression (TTP) assessed by BIRC, and ORR, DCR, DoR, TTP, PFS and PFS2 assessed by investigator; -To evaluate the safety of pyrotinib versus docetaxel in patients with advanced HER2 exon20-mutated non-squamous NSCLC who have progressed after treated with platinum based chemotherapy; -To evaluate patient reported outcomes (PRO) in pyrotinib versus docetaxel treatment arms; -To evaluate pharmacokinetics (PK) of pyrotinib in patients with advanced HER2 exon20-mutated non-squamous NSCLC who have progressed after treated with platinum based chemotherapy;;Primary end point(s): PFS evaluated by the blinded independent review committee (BIRC) based on Response Evaluation Criteria in Solid Tumors Version 1.1 (RECIST v1.1).;Timepoint(s) of evaluation of this end point: PFS will be collected on Day 1 of each dosing cycle, at discontinuation of treatment/withdrawal, at safety follow-up: 28 days (±7) after the last dose and at Survival follow-up (comes after safety followup). Every 56 days (±7 days) after the last dose investigators must follow up subject’s survival via phone calls.
